Summary

This trial tests whether a self-administered vaginal swab, analyzed with advanced molecular technology, can detect and treat bacterial imbalances early in pregnancy. Pregnant women at high risk of preterm birth will either receive this screening plus targeted antibiotics or standard care. The goal is to see if this approach reduces the rate of preterm birth before 37 weeks.

Active substance
Molecular screening test for vaginal flora abnormalities, followed by targeted antibiotic treatment (e.g., azithromycin) if an infection is found
What this could lead to
If effective, this approach could offer a simple, at-home screening method to identify and treat vaginal infections early, potentially reducing preterm births and improving newborn health.
What could go wrong
The trial is large but still experimental; the screening may not catch all infections, and antibiotics may have side effects. Results may not apply to all pregnant women.
